Workday Adaptive Planning remains a staple for larger business that need deep combination with human capital management systems. In 2026, it is preferred by companies that have already moved their entire HR and finance stack to the Workday environment. It stands out at intricate modeling and labor force preparation, though the application process can be lengthy. For organizations in the national market that have the budget for a considerable setup, it supplies a high degree of customization for global operations.

Anaplan is typically chosen by high-growth firms that require to model extremely large datasets throughout numerous organization systems. Its strength depends on its capability to connect information from supply chains, sales, and finance into a single model. While it requires a devoted admin to handle the technical aspects, the power it supplies for scenario planning in 2026 is significant. Companies facing volatile market conditions utilize it to run countless "what-if" circumstances to prepare for various economic shifts.
Vena has built its reputation on keeping the familiar Excel interface while adding a protected database on the backend. This is especially useful for teams that are reluctant to provide up the flexibility of spreadsheets but need the variation control and audit routes of a modern-day SaaS tool. In 2026, Vena stays popular amongst financing groups that want to reduce the knowing curve for department heads who are currently comfy with traditional grid-based preparation.
Planful focuses on the end-to-end financial close and preparation procedure. It is a preferred choice for organizations that wish to reduce their regular monthly close cycle while simultaneously updating their rolling forecasts. The platform stresses speed and accuracy, offering tools that help bridge the gap between accounting and tactical finance. For a specialized finance team, Planful offers a structured environment that reduces the time invested in data debt consolidation.

Prophix has actually invested greatly in automation for mid-market companies. It uses automated workflows to handle repetitive jobs like information collection and report circulation. This releases up the finance team to focus on higher-level strategy. For business in various regions that are looking to reduce headcount in the back workplace while increasing output, Prophix supplies a path toward extremely efficient monetary operations.
Mosaic is a strategic finance platform that incorporates directly with a company's ERP, CRM, and HRIS. It is particularly developed for the tech-heavy environment of 2026, where data is scattered across multiple SaaS tools. By pulling all this information into one location, it provides finance leaders a holistic view of the service. It is particularly popular among startups that have just recently closed a funding round and need to scale their reporting abilities rapidly.
Cube uses a lean method to FP&A. Like Vena, it enables users to remain in Excel or Google Sheets while providing a central data repository. It is developed for speed and simpleness, making it a preferred for financing groups of one or 2 people who require to handle complicated budgets without the overhead of a huge business system. Its concentrate on connection makes it a helpful bridge for companies moving toward a more structured monetary stack.
Centage supplies sophisticated capital forecasting and balance sheet modeling for the mid-market. Its "Planning Genius" software is understood for its capability to handle complex estimations without needing the user to compose solutions. This lowers the danger of reasoning errors, which is a major issue for companies in high-stakes markets. The platform offers a clear view of future liquidity, assisting services make notified choices about capital investment.
Jirav is intended at small-to-mid-sized businesses that require a professional appearance to their financial models without the business price. It includes templates for P&L, balance sheets, and headcounts, enabling teams to get a budget up and running in days instead of months. In 2026, it remains a go-to for professional services firms that need to supply clear reporting to their partners and stakeholders.
